What I Check Before Buying
Before I choose any Spring Valley Vitamin, I always look at a few important things:
- Ingredient list: I check what is actually inside the bottle and whether it matches my needs.
- Dosage: I make sure the serving size feels right for me and is not more than I need.
- Purpose: I decide whether I want a multivitamin, a single nutrient, or a specialty formula.
- Expiration date: I always check freshness before buying.
- Price: I compare the cost with similar products so I know I am getting good value.

How I Decide Which One Is Right for Me
My buying decision usually depends on my personal health goals. If I want general daily support, I go for a multivitamin. If I already eat well and only need one nutrient, I prefer a single vitamin. I also think about whether I have any dietary restrictions or sensitivities, since that can affect which product I feel comfortable using.

Things I Keep in Mind
Even though I like the convenience, I still stay careful. I remind myself that supplements are not a replacement for a balanced diet. I also make sure to follow the label directions and, when needed, I talk to a healthcare professional before starting a new vitamin routine.
